How Pokémon Got Their Names


  NEW! Poetry and Doll Maker with Galleries!     [Learn About Our Ecommerce]
Graphics Gallery!

Characters
Ash Ketchum: Not sure about his first name, but his last name is in the pharse "Gotta CACTH EM All."
Misty: Likes water Pokémon.
Brock: Likes Rock Pokémon (Brock, rock)
Tracey: Draws, traces
Prof. Oak: No clue!
Nurse Joy: Always cheerful
Officer Jenny: Well, she's a police officer. That's all I know.
Jesse and James: Named after the cowboy robber, Jesse James, thus making them "Jesse and James."
Cassidy and Butch: No idea! Maybe also a cowboy robber?
Lt. Surge: Well, look at him! Army suit, electric Pokémon!
Erika: Erika means "gentle" and Erika is always this.
Sabrina: Remember "Sabrina the Teenage Witch?" She had powers, and so does the Gym Leader Sabrina.
Koga: Ninja name
Blaine: Blaine means "burn."
Giovanni: Uhhh....is he an opera singer?

Pokémon:
Bulbasaur: Bulb on back
Ivysaur: Ivy on back
Venusaur: Named after the venus fly-trap.
Charmander: "Char" means burn, mander in "salamander."
Charmeleon: "Char" means burn, meleon in "chameleon."
Charizard: "Char" means burn, izard in "lizard."
Squirtle: Turtle Pokémon, squirts water.
Wartortle: Has war marks on face, turtle Pokémon.
Blastoise: Blasts its enemies with water.
Caterpie: Caterpillar Pokémon.
Metapod: Pod around it.
Butterfree: Butterfly Pokémon.
Weedle: ??????
Kakuna: Well duh, it's in a cocoon!
Beedrill: Bee Pokémon, drills on hands.
Pidgey: Pidgeon
Pidgeotto: Pidgeon
Pidgeot: Pidgeon
Rattata: Rat Pokémon
Raticate: Rate Pokémon
Spearow: Sparrow Pokémon
Fearow: Sparrow Pokémon
Ekans: Name spells "snake" backwards
Arbok: "Name spells "kobra" (Cobra) backwards
Pikachu: Pika is an animal that lives all over eastern Asia, and chu meaning "electric."
Raichu: "Rai=Rat", chu=electric
Sandshrew: Its digs in sand, it's a shrew
Sandslash: Digs in sand, slash enemies
Nidoran F: ?????
Nidorina: ?????
Nidoqueen: Female=queen
Nidoran M: ?????
Nidorino: ?????
Nidoking: male=king
Clefairy: Fairy Pokémon
Clefable: ?????
Vulpix: Comes from the Latin word "Vulpes" meaning fox and "ix" for its SIX tails.
Ninetales: Well, duh! Nine tails=Ninetales!
Jigglypuff: A puff of fur, looks like Jiggly Jello.
Wigglytuff: Looks like wiggly Jello?
Zubat: Bat Pokémon
Golbat: Bat Pokémon
Oddish: Looks odd
Gloom: Looks gloomy
Vileplume: Has a bloom of flowers on its head (Bloom, plume)
Paras: Parasite, paras.
Parasect: Parasite, parasect.
Venonat: Gnat Pokémon
Venomoth: Moth Pokémon
Diglett: Digs holes
Dugtrio: Digs, a trio of Diglett together
Meowth: Cat Pokémon, cats say "meow"
Squirtle: Naw, really?
Oh, be quiet.
Persian: Persia cat
Psyduck: Psychic, duck.
Golduck: Duck Pokémon
Mankey: Monkey Pokémon
Primeape: Ape Pokémon
Growlithe: Dog Pokémon, growls
Arcanine: Canine Pokémon
Poliwag: Poliwog (meaning tadpole) Pokémon
Poliwhirl: Poliwog Pokémon, hirl on stomach
Poliwrath: Poliwog Pokémon
Abra: Part of magic word "Abrakadabra"
Kadabra: Second part of magic word, "Abrakadabra"
Alakazam: Magic word
Machop: Karate chops
Machoke: Can choke enemies????
Machamp: Champion Pokémon
Bellsprout: Sprout Pokémon
Weepinbell: Looks sad, bell flower Pokémon
Victreebel: Bell flower Pokémon, thrilled with victory.
Tentacool: Jellyfish Pokémon
Tentacruel: Looks mean
Geodude: "Geo" means "earth" and rock is from the earth
Graveler: Gravel is made from rock
Golem: "Golem" means "heavy" and "big"
